Emilio G. Cota <address@hidden> writes:
> These are a few muladd-related operations that the original IBM syntax
> does not specify; model files for these are in muladd.fptest.
>
> Signed-off-by: Emilio G. Cota <address@hidden>
> ---
> tests/fp-test/fp-test.c | 24 +++++++++++++++++++++
> tests/fp-test/muladd.fptest | 51
> +++++++++++++++++++++++++++++++++++++++++++++
> 2 files changed, 75 insertions(+)
> create mode 100644 tests/fp-test/muladd.fptest
>
> diff --git a/tests/fp-test/fp-test.c b/tests/fp-test/fp-test.c
> index 27637c4..2200d40 100644
> --- a/tests/fp-test/fp-test.c
> +++ b/tests/fp-test/fp-test.c
> @@ -53,6 +53,9 @@ enum op {
> OP_SUB,
> OP_MUL,
> OP_MULADD,
> + OP_MULADD_NEG_ADDEND,
> + OP_MULADD_NEG_PRODUCT,
> + OP_MULADD_NEG_RESULT,
> OP_DIV,
> OP_SQRT,
> OP_MINNUM,
> @@ -69,6 +72,9 @@ static const struct op_desc ops[] = {
> [OP_SUB] = { "-", 2 },
> [OP_MUL] = { "*", 2 },
> [OP_MULADD] = { "*+", 3 },
> + [OP_MULADD_NEG_ADDEND] = { "*+nc", 3 },
> + [OP_MULADD_NEG_PRODUCT] = { "*+np", 3 },
> + [OP_MULADD_NEG_RESULT] = { "*+nr", 3 },
> [OP_DIV] = { "/", 2 },
> [OP_SQRT] = { "V", 1 },
> [OP_MINNUM] = { "<C", 2 },
> @@ -463,6 +469,15 @@ static enum error soft_tester(struct test_op *t)
> case OP_MULADD:
> res = float32_muladd(a, b, c, 0, s);
> break;
> + case OP_MULADD_NEG_ADDEND:
> + res = float32_muladd(a, b, c, float_muladd_negate_c, s);
> + break;
> + case OP_MULADD_NEG_PRODUCT:
> + res = float32_muladd(a, b, c, float_muladd_negate_product, s);
> + break;
> + case OP_MULADD_NEG_RESULT:
> + res = float32_muladd(a, b, c, float_muladd_negate_result, s);
> + break;
> case OP_DIV:
> res = float32_div(a, b, s);
> break;
> @@ -522,6 +537,15 @@ static enum error soft_tester(struct test_op *t)
> case OP_MULADD:
> res64 = float64_muladd(a, b, c, 0, s);
> break;
> + case OP_MULADD_NEG_ADDEND:
> + res64 = float64_muladd(a, b, c, float_muladd_negate_c, s);
> + break;
> + case OP_MULADD_NEG_PRODUCT:
> + res64 = float64_muladd(a, b, c, float_muladd_negate_product, s);
> + break;
> + case OP_MULADD_NEG_RESULT:
> + res64 = float64_muladd(a, b, c, float_muladd_negate_result, s);
> + break;
> case OP_DIV:
> res64 = float64_div(a, b, s);
> break;
Are there any intrinsics we could use for the hard variant which would
be useful if we want to run under translation?
